Before this year I never used Scent Blocker. I had always showered and use cover scent however, but always thought the suit was to expensive.

I finally gave in a spend $170 for the fleece suit this year. I was VERY pleased. I saw more deer, and bigger bucks. Usually in past years I would see about 2-3 deer on average, but this year that jumped to about 8-10 on most days. Well worth the money IMO.

its all opinions!! some say yea,some say naa. i use it. shower daily in the soaps,dress in the field,give my self and gear a liberal dosing of scent a way b4 heading to stand. does it work? i think so. but the question really is will it work for you? my opinion is. if it keeps you in that stand longer,then its worth it. nothing can beat a well placed stand with a hunter logging many hours in it.again,just an opinion!!!!!
